A Japanese zoo reassured the public that 6-month-old orphaned macaque monkey Punch-kun is safe and sound after a video of him being dragged by another monkey went viral. The zoo explained this is normal social behavior and part of Punch's learning process.
FILE - A macaque monkey looks on at Qianling Park on May 29, 2017 in Guiyang, China. A zoo in Japan assured the public that an adorable 6monthold monkey named Punch-kun is OK after video went viral of him apparently being dragged by another monkey.
The footage circulating on social media shows Punch, an orphaned Japanese macaque, running away from the monkey and retrieving to a corner at the"We have confirmed that several videos have gone viral on the internet. When Punch approached another baby monkey from the troop in attempt to communicate, the baby monkey avoided him. Punch then sat down, apparently giving up on communicating with the monkey, after which he was scolded and dragged by an adult monkey," The zookeepers explained that the behavior is a normal form of discipline within macaque social groups. They added that Punch is still young and learning how to socialize. Punch, who was born on July 26, 2025 and abandoned by his mother at birth, has been living with the troop since January 19. "The monkey that dragged Punch is probably the mother of the monkey with whom Punch tried to communicate. She probably felt that her baby was annoyed by Punch and got upset, expressing 'don't be mean,'" the statement noted. "Punch has been scolded by other monkeys many times in the past and has learned how to socialize with them." While the zoo said he seeks comfort from the orangutan plushie, the behavior is typical for a monkey his age. “In the video, Punch runs to his stuffed orangutan toy after being dragged. However, as usual, he left the stuffed toy after a short while and was communicating with other monkeys," the zoo said, adding that they believe the footage was recorded on Thursday morning.“In order to integrate Punch into other Japanese monkey troops, we anticipated that this kind of challenge may arise,” the zoo said. "Although Punch has been scolded many times by other monkeys, no single monkey has shown serious aggression toward him. While Plush is scolded, he shows resilience and mental strength.
